Effective Strategies for Enhancing Client Engagement

To implement a successful client-centric marketing strategy, you must focus on enhancing client engagement. This involves creating meaningful interactions that resonate with your clients and encourage them to return to your business. Here are some effective strategies to consider:

  • Personalized Communication: Tailor your communication to reflect the individual preferences and needs of your clients. Use personalized emails, messages, and offers to make them feel valued and understood.
  • Feedback Mechanisms: Establish channels for clients to provide feedback on your services. This not only helps you improve but also shows clients that their opinions matter.
  • Consistent Value Delivery: Ensure that you consistently deliver high-quality services that meet or exceed client expectations. This builds trust and encourages repeat business.
  • Engaging Content: Create content that addresses the interests and concerns of your clients. This could include blog posts, newsletters, or informative videos that provide value and keep clients informed.

Crafting a Client-Centric Marketing Strategy

Developing a client-centric marketing strategy requires a comprehensive approach that integrates various elements of your business operations. Here are some key components to consider:

  • Client Segmentation: Divide your client base into segments based on specific characteristics such as demographics, behavior, or needs. This allows you to tailor your marketing efforts to each segment effectively.
  • Data-Driven Insights: Utilize data analytics to gain insights into client behavior and preferences. This information can guide your marketing decisions and help you predict future trends.
  • Cross-Channel Integration: Ensure that your marketing efforts are consistent across all channels, whether online or offline. This creates a seamless experience for clients and reinforces your brand message.
  • Client Journey Mapping: Map out the client journey to understand each touchpoint and interaction they have with your business. This helps identify opportunities for improvement and enhances the overall client experience.

Leveraging Technology for Enhanced Client Engagement

Incorporating technology into your client-centric marketing strategies can significantly boost engagement. Tools such as Customer Relationship Management (CRM) systems enable you to track client interactions and preferences, allowing for more personalized marketing efforts. By analyzing data collected through these systems, you can identify trends and tailor your services to better meet client needs.

Additionally, consider utilizing chatbots and automated responses for initial client inquiries. These technologies can provide immediate assistance, ensuring that clients feel valued and attended to. However, it's important to balance automation with human interaction to maintain a personal touch.

Implementing a Multi-Channel Marketing Strategy

A multi-channel marketing strategy is essential for reaching clients where they are most active. By utilizing various platforms such as social media, email marketing, and content marketing, you can create a cohesive and engaging client experience. Each channel should reflect your brand's voice and values, ensuring consistency across all interactions.

Consider the preferences of your target audience when selecting channels. For instance, platforms like LinkedIn may be more effective for professional services, while Instagram could be ideal for visually-driven businesses. By strategically leveraging these channels, you can enhance client engagement and expand your reach.
